The Bloc Québécois has tabled a bill in the House of Commons that deals with affordable social housing. That bill called for surpluses built up at the Canada Mortgage and Housing Corporation to be invested in social housing, through a reserve of $1 billion. I believe there are currently annual surpluses of $100 million; I can't remember the exact amount. We are proposing that beyond that, any surpluses that are accumulating and are not controlled by Parliament for the time being be invested in affordable social housing.
Would you recommend that members of Parliament support such a bill?
